Bayside covers the Smoking Popes

In 1997, the Smoking Popes released Destination Failure, which included the track “Megan.” Countless bands list the Popes as one of their influences, and a few of them even pay homage to the Chicago-based quartet. What isn’t common though, is for a band to cover the Popes and have Josh Caterer join in for a verse. That’s exactly what New York’s Bayside did. In February of 2006, following the death of their drummer, Bayside released the aptly named Acoustic, which featured acoustic versions of their own songs as well as a cover of the Smoking Popes’ “Megan.”

Following the acoustic motif of the album, the Bayside version of the song is…you guessed it, acoustic. Anthony Raneri’s voice gives the impression that he isn’t singing about a woman, but about his lost band mate. Josh Caterer sings the second verse of the song accompanied by a single acoustic guitar before the acoustic recreation of Eli Caterer’s solo on the Destination Failure version of the track. “Megan” is a fitting song to cover on an album that is a tribute to John “Beatz” Holohan. The lyrics lament both Caterer and Raneri’s reluctance to let go of someone that was obviously very important to them, even if they’re both singing about completely different people.
